Output 31d10de89cc751a71b9c2a455817a6005c7bcb8d4778e6d66f477954022c4025:2

value
167984509
script pubkey
OP_0 OP_PUSHBYTES_20 7ca9240f74b1640659018eb337c4f82fc7ae663b
address
bc1q0j5jgrm5k9jqvkgp36en038c9lr6ue3m7dj0vc
transaction
31d10de89cc751a71b9c2a455817a6005c7bcb8d4778e6d66f477954022c4025
spent
true